Create Your Account
Download Newie on iPhone or Mac, or open the web app. Sign up, verify your email where prompted, and fill in your profile details, such as name, business name where relevant, profession, service details, and profile photo.See Account & Profile for the full setup.
Create Your First Service
A service is what customers buy from you. Newie supports three types:
- Subscription - recurring billing on a schedule (weekly, monthly, etc.) until paused or cancelled.
- One-Off Purchase - a single-purchase service with one invoice and payment.
- Installment Plan - a fixed total split across a set number of scheduled payments.
Set Up Payouts
Complete payout setup when Newie prompts you during onboarding or from the Home screen. Select the country where your bank account or business is based, then continue to Stripe to complete payout onboarding, including bank account, identity, and business details.See Payouts for payout schedules, payment clearing time, and Instant Payouts.
Share Your Service
Common ways to take a customer through to payment include:
- Link. Every service gets a customer-facing link (
share.newie.app/offerings/...) you can paste anywhere — Instagram, email, SMS, iMessage, your website. - QR Code. Download or display a QR code customers scan to open the same payment page.
- Tap to Pay. Take an in-person card or digital wallet payment on a supported iPhone after Tap to Pay has been enabled separately.
Take Your First Payment
When a customer pays, Newie automatically:
- Sends them a Purchase Confirmation email (and a Welcome Email if you’ve configured one).
- Adds the funds to your Newie payout balances while they clear.
- Sends you a push notification and email for the new sale.
